氧氯化法生产二氯乙烷的废碱液回收利用 总被引:1,自引:1,他引:0
为消除氧氯化法生产二氟乙烷中产生的废碱液对系统水处理的影响,采用蒸馏法对废碱液进行单独处理,实现碱液中的二氯乙烷含量降低至1μg/g以下,满足废水处理要求.该改造工程投用后生产稳定,废碱液得到综合利用,具有良好的经济效益和环境效益. 相似文献

介绍二氯乙烷精馏单元尾气回收改造情况,将二氯乙烷精馏单元尾气由洗涤放空改为进焚烧单元焚烧,改造后每年可节约390余万元,并减轻了环境污染,改善了大气环境。 相似文献

Three different types of gas distributors were used in an external loop airlift slurry reactor to investigate the hydrodynamic characteristics. To predict the important hydrodynamic parameters, such as the total gas holdup, the slurry circulating velocity, the bubble size distribution, and the slip velocity between the gas phase and the slurry phase, the correlations are developed. The calculated results fit the experimental data very well. According to the influence of the solid holdup on the bubble size, the fluid flow in the reactor can be divided into two regimes, while a 10% value is regarded as the critical solid holdup value. When εs is≤10%, the bubble size is determined by both the gas phase and the slurry phase. When εs is ≥10%, the bubble size is determined mainly by the slurry phase. By analyzing the relationship between the slip velocity and the gas holdup, the bubble coalescence plays a key role in the slurry reactor. 相似文献
